Yves Soyfer

Managing Director, Alternative Financing Group

From 2007 to 2011 Mr. Soyfer worked for MIZUHO INTERNATIONAL PLC as a Managing Director in the Strategic Finance and Solutions team. Mr. Soyfer was actively involved in transactions sourcing of financing for asset acquisition such as Specialized Vessel, Rigs, and Wind Farms to energy related contractors with long term contracts in developing countries (Mexico, Columbia, Brazil, Venezuela, Argentina and North Africa). From 2005 to 2007 Mr. Soyfer was the founding partner of INTELLECTUAL CAPITAL PARTNER (ICP), a structured finance boutique which originated and invested in illiquid assets in Latin America. In 2007 Mizuho bought out the IntelCap business. Prior to IntelCap, Mr. Soyfer worked from 2003 to 2005 for DEUTSCHE BANK AG (DB) in London as a Director in the Alternative Asset Group, the first Alternative Asset Group to be deployed by an investment bank within the capital markets. Prior to joining DB, Mr. Soyfer headed from 2001 to 2003 the European and East-European Credit Structured Group at MIZUHO INTERNATIONAL plc. in London. From 1998 to 2001, Mr. Soyfer was Executive Director and European Head of Sales for fixed income products in GREENWICH NATWEST (which merged to ROYAL BANK OF SCOTLAND in 2000). Previously, in the period 1997-98, Mr. Soyfer headed the French distribution for NOMURA UK in London and from 1995 to 1997, Mr. Soyfer worked for CREDIT SUISSE FIRST BOSTON in London as a Director. He started his career in 1993 working in Paris as a Vice-President in SWISS BANK CORPORATION. Mr. Soyfer graduated in Economics for the University of Aix en Provence.
